Syrsky suggested how long Ukraine can hold out without US assistance.


Ukraine will be able to resist Russian occupiers even without US assistance. This was stated by the Commander-in-Chief of the Armed Forces of Ukraine Oleksandr Syrsky during an interview with LB.ua. He noted that Ukraine receives the greatest support from European partners, and assistance from the US has decreased. Nevertheless, Ukraine is successfully developing its own defense industry, particularly in the fields of artillery, drones, and electronic warfare systems. This experience has intrigued European partners. According to Syrsky, Ukraine should rely on its own strengths.
It should be noted that the US restored military aid to Ukraine in March. However, a possible meeting between President Trump and Putin could have negative consequences not only for Ukraine but also for Europe. There is a possibility of NATO troops being withdrawn by the US, which would leave Europe vulnerable to Russian forces. Despite this, the Pentagon stated that no decision has been made regarding the withdrawal of troops from Europe.
It is worth mentioning that the US army also announced the withdrawal of its troops and equipment from the Polish hub in Yasenka, through which assistance was provided to Ukraine.
